Practical tips for replacing fascia board
First determine the working height you need: allow roughly 2 metres above the point where you are working on the fascia board.
Make sure the scaffold is level and stable; use the adjustable feet on uneven ground.
Keep tools and materials within reach on the platform, so you don't have to keep climbing down.
Do not work in strong wind (force 6 or above) and lock the wheel brakes before climbing up.
